Blood Orange Gin Sparkler

Servings 1 drink
Author Brandon Matzek

Ingredients

For the rosemary-bay simple syrup:

  • 1 cup white sugar
  • 2 cups water
  • 2 teaspoons fresh rosemary leaves, no stems
  • 1 fresh bay leaf, dried is fine if you can't find a fresh one

For the cocktail:

  • 1 1/2 oz. freshly squeezed blood orange juice
  • 1 1/2 oz. gin
  • 1/4 oz rosemary-bay simple syrup, or to taste
  • 1 1/2 oz. sparkling water
  • Small wedges of blood orange, for garnish

Instructions

  • To make the rosemary-bay simple syrup, add white sugar, water, fresh rosemary leaves and bay leaf to a small, heavy-bottomed pan. Warm over medium heat, stirring until sugar is completely dissolved. Bring mixture to a boil, bubble for 1 minute, then remove from heat. Steep for 10 minutes then strain out the rosemary and bay. Discard solids. Let cool completely before using.
  • To make the cocktail, fill a short glass with ice then add freshly squeezed blood orange juice, gin and rosemary-bay simple syrup, stirring to chill and combine. Top off with sparkling water. Give the drink one last gentle stir then garnish with a small wedge of blood orange.
